As one of the most widely used web browsers globally, Google Chrome has garnered both praise for its speed and capability and criticism for its high RAM consumption. Users often find themselves frustrated as they navigate multiple tabs or run resource-intensive applications, leading to significant slowdowns or crashes. Understanding the underlying causes of Chrome’s RAM usage is essential for users seeking to optimize their browsing experience. This article delves into the reasons behind Chrome’s memory demands and evaluates potential solutions for mitigating the associated issues, ultimately aiming to enhance user efficiency and satisfaction.
Understanding the Causes of Chrome’s RAM Consumption Issues
Google Chrome’s design philosophy revolves around speed and performance, which can inadvertently lead to increased RAM consumption. One primary reason for this is the browser’s architecture, which isolates tabs in separate processes. While this design enhances security and stability—ensuring that a crash in one tab does not affect others—it also means that each tab and extension consumes a portion of the available RAM. Consequently, users may notice that even with a few tabs open, Chrome can be a significant drain on system memory.
Moreover, Chrome’s extensive use of JavaScript can further exacerbate RAM usage. Modern websites are increasingly interactive and dynamic, relying on JavaScript frameworks that require substantial computing resources. As a result, each open tab can create a memory-intensive environment, especially when dealing with multimedia content or complex web applications. This situation is compounded by the tendency of users to keep multiple tabs open simultaneously, leading to a cumulative effect that can overwhelm system resources.
Additionally, Chrome’s robust extension ecosystem contributes to its memory footprint. Extensions add functionality and convenience, but they can also be resource hogs. Each extension often runs in its own process, paralleling the tab architecture, which can significantly amplify RAM usage. Users may not realize that while an extension appears innocuous, it could be a major contributor to the browser’s overall memory consumption, underscoring the need for users to be mindful of the extensions they install.
Evaluating Solutions to Optimize Chrome’s Memory Usage
To address Chrome’s high RAM usage, users can implement several strategies designed to optimize performance. One effective approach is to make use of Chrome’s built-in Task Manager, which allows users to monitor memory consumption on a per-tab and per-extension basis. By analyzing which tabs or extensions are consuming the most resources, users can identify and close unnecessary ones, freeing up RAM and enhancing browser responsiveness. This proactive monitoring can lead to a more efficient browsing experience, particularly for users who frequently have numerous tabs open.
Another practical solution is to utilize lightweight alternatives or extensions that manage tab usage. Various extensions are specifically designed to suspend inactive tabs, reducing their memory footprint by unloading them from RAM while keeping them readily accessible. By implementing such tools, users can maintain a clutter-free browsing environment without sacrificing usability. This strategy allows for a balance between convenience and performance, ensuring that Chrome remains functional without overwhelming the system’s resources.
Lastly, users can consider adopting best practices for tab management and browser usage. This includes regularly reviewing and disabling unnecessary extensions, employing bookmark folders to minimize open tabs, and utilizing Chrome’s built-in features like “Tab Groups” for better organization. By developing a more mindful approach to browsing and making informed choices about extension use, users can significantly mitigate Chrome’s RAM consumption issues and, in turn, enjoy a smoother and more productive browsing experience.
In conclusion, while Google Chrome’s high RAM usage can pose challenges for users, understanding the reasons behind this issue and implementing effective solutions can greatly enhance the browsing experience. By recognizing the impact of Chrome’s architecture, the role of JavaScript, and the influence of extensions, users can take informed steps to optimize their browser’s performance. Through careful management of tabs and resources, users can harness the power of Chrome without succumbing to its propensity for consuming system memory. Ultimately, a strategic approach to browser usage can lead to improved efficiency and satisfaction, allowing users to navigate the online world with ease.